Mission & Objectives

The Science Education department is committed to:

  • strengthening education in biology and related sciences,

  • advancing public understanding and appreciation of science, and

  • broadening access to science for all persons, including women and members of groups underrepresented in the sciences.

HHMI's grants and fellowships, administered by the Science Education department, provide funding for pre-K–12 and undergraduate science education, graduate science education and medical student research training.
